Zelensky is apparently in Saudi Arabia right now.

In general, I've seen news about Ukraine assisting the GCC states with drone defense especially. I haven't seen any reporting on what the upside is for Ukraine here. I have no doubt that there is one - and good for Ukraine - but what is it?

Baron von Schtinkenbutt

#20255
The energy crisis has been a boon for Russia.  I suspect this was part of the motivation for the strikes on the Baltic oil and gas terminals a couple days ago.  So, Ukraine has a vested interest in reducing its impact, and they can do so by helping the GCC secure the Strait of Hormuz and their oil and gas facilities.

Grey Fox

Quote from: Jacob on Today at 12:34:17 PMZelensky is apparently in Saudi Arabia right now.

In general, I've seen news about Ukraine assisting the GCC states with drone defense especially. I haven't seen any reporting on what the upside is for Ukraine here. I have no doubt that there is one - and good for Ukraine - but what is it?

Massive investment in Ukraine's missile & missile defense industry. Apparently their technology is good, and obviously real world tested, but they lack capital for production scale up.
